How Does Carbon Fiber Bicycle Frames Work?

02 Jul.,2024

 

Have you ever wondered how those sleek carbon fiber bicycle frames work? In this article, we will break down the science behind these lightweight and strong materials that are revolutionizing the world of cycling.

1. Lightweight and Strong Material.

Carbon fiber is a composite material that is made up of individual carbon filaments that are woven together. These filaments are then bonded using a resin to create a material that is incredibly strong and lightweight.

2. Resistant to Fatigue.

One of the key benefits of carbon fiber is its resistance to fatigue. This means that even after thousands of cycles of stress and strain, carbon fiber retains its strength and integrity. This is crucial in a bicycle frame, where riders put a lot of stress on the material during each ride.

3. Directional Strength.

Another advantage of carbon fiber is its directional strength. This means that the material can be engineered to be strongest in the direction that will experience the most stress. This allows bicycle manufacturers to design frames that are both lightweight and incredibly stiff, providing a responsive ride for cyclists.

4. Vibration Dampening.

Carbon fiber is also known for its ability to dampen vibrations. This means that riders will feel less road chatter and bumps when riding on a carbon fiber frame, providing a smoother and more comfortable ride.

5. Customizable Design.

Carbon fiber is a highly customizable material. Manufacturers can vary the thickness, weave, and orientation of the carbon fibers to create frames that are tailored to specific rider preferences. This allows for frames that are stiff and responsive, as well as frames that are more compliant and forgiving.
